Catalog: BLP-009533 |
Molecular Formula: C4H4D5NO3 |
Molecular Weight: 124.15 |
Chemical Structure |
---|
![]() |
Description | L-Threonine-[d5] is a deuterium labelled L-Threonin. L-Threonine is a natural amino acid, can be produced by microbial fermentation, and is used in food, medicine, or feed. |
Synonyms | (2S,3R)-2-amino-3-hydroxy-butanoic acid-d5 |
Related CAS | 72-19-5 (unlabelled) |
InChI | InChI=1S/C4H9NO3/c1-2(6)3(5)4(7)8/h2-3,6H,5H2,1H3,(H,7,8)/t2-,3?/m0/s1/i1D3,2D,3D |
InChI Key | AYFVYJQAPQTCCC-VDTRXZDESA-N |
Purity | 98% by CP; 98% atom D |
Appearance | White Solid |
L-Threonine-[d5] is an isotopically labeled amino acid used in various scientific and industrial applications. Here are some key applications of L-Threonine-[d5]:
Metabolic Flux Analysis: L-Threonine-[d5] is used in metabolic flux analysis to trace metabolic pathways and quantify fluxes in biological systems. By incorporating this labeled amino acid into metabolic studies, researchers can monitor its incorporation and turnover in various metabolic processes. This helps in understanding the dynamics and regulation of metabolic networks in organisms.
Protein Structure Analysis: In structural biology, L-Threonine-[d5] can be used in NMR spectroscopy and mass spectrometry for protein structure determination. The deuterium labeling provides enhanced resolution and better understanding of protein folding, interactions, and dynamics. This isotopic labeling is crucial for elucidating the conformational changes and binding sites of proteins.
Nutritional Studies: L-Threonine-[d5] is used in nutritional research to study amino acid metabolism and nutrient utilization. By administering this labeled amino acid, scientists can track its absorption, distribution, and incorporation into proteins. This application is essential for optimizing dietary formulations and understanding the role of specific amino acids in nutrition.
Pharmacokinetics: In pharmaceutical research, L-Threonine-[d5] is employed to investigate the pharmacokinetics of drugs and their metabolites. The isotopic labeling helps in distinguishing the administered compound from endogenous substances, allowing precise monitoring of drug absorption, distribution, metabolism, and excretion. This data is vital for drug development and optimizing therapeutic regimens.
